Lucas Ariel Villarruel (born 13 November 1990) is an Argentine professional footballer who plays as a midfielder for L.D.U. Quito.[1]

Career

Villarruel started his career in 2012 with Huracán.[1][2] He made his debut on 5 March in an away win against Boca Unidos in Primera B Nacional, which was the first of seven appearances during 2011–12.[1] In November 2012, Villarruel scored his first senior goal in a 0–4 win versus Almirante Brown.[1] At the end of the 2014 Primera B Nacional season, after he had scored two goals in ninety-seven appearances, Huracán won promotion to the Argentine Primera División.[1][3] On 30 June 2016, Olimpo signed Villarruel on loan for the 2016–17 campaign.[1][4] After twenty-seven appearances in all competitions, his loan was renewed in July 2017.[5]

He returned to Huracán on 16 May 2018, following a total of fifty appearances for Olimpo over two seasons for Olimpo.[6] Villarruel joined Defensa y Justicia in the following July.[1] After six matches in twelve months for Defensa, Villarruel left on loan in August 2019 to league counterparts Newell's Old Boys.[1] He remained until the succeeding December, appearing twelve times for them; though just four were as a starter.[1] January 2020 saw Villarruel head abroad for the first time, joining Ecuadorian Serie A club L.D.U. Quito on loan for one year.[1] He made his debut in a three-goal Clásico Quiteño victory away to El Nacional on 28 February, with his first goal arriving on 3 October against Mushuc Runa.[1]
